French President Emmanuel Macron has extended an invitation to China for foreign direct investments in key European sectors, aiming to foster growth and technology exchange. Speaking at the World Economic Forum in Davos on January 20, 2026, Macron emphasized the importance of balancing trade relations by encouraging investments over subsidized exports that could undermine European industries.
Macron's proposal seeks to address trade imbalances caused by Chinese overcapacities and advocates for a legal framework to protect European markets. While the initiative focuses on traditional markets, it could influence future trade negotiations and set new precedents in global trade policies.
